Well before the new update everything was focused on a Dantooine Grind - players would get up to Combat Level 80 in days...not sure if that still happens though.

And it was because of that grind that I stopped with the grinding and went for crafting professions which can be very satifying when your lounging around the house you crafted from materials you located and mined, and the furniture all of which you made, just hanging on guild chat.

Plus I only have half the physical memory that i ecommended to play it...so Combat got a little laggy most of the time aswell as transport between planets.

Another thing that begun to bug me was the emphasis on high level only quests, leaving little to do for anyone else apart from grinding, Mustafa (the latest planet added) pretty much neglects low levels entirely...
